Flat 13, The Atrium, 60 Redcliff Street, Bristol, BS1 6LS is a leasehold flat built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 1,033 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£353,108 , which equates to approximately £342 per square foot. It was last sold on 28 Oct 2022 for £357,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£3,892, representing a 1.1% decrease, or approximately 0.3% per year.

The current estimated value of £353,108 is:

  • 34.0% lower than the average property price on Redcliff Street
  • 12.2% lower than the average in the BS1 6LS postcode area
  • and 21.4% lower than the average price for Bristol as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 21 February 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

Flat 13, The Atrium, 60 Redcliff Street, Bristol, City Of Bristol, BS1 6LS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 21 Feb 2022.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 23 Apr 2014,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to E,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 66.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The wall construction or insulation changed from sol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, as built,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from full secondary gl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 83%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
